Dirtsheets (All from Observer):

Quote:

Since a lot of people have asked about this related to Mysterio and last week’s issue, all standard WWE contracts are written with the clause that the company can extend the contract based on the wrestlers not performing for an extended period of time due to an injury. So WWE doing the automatic renewal of his expiring contract is something specifically mentioned in his deal and in all standard deals.
Quote:

The ring outfit of Rollins is a point of discussion right now. As part of current plans this week, Rollins is not going to be a member of Evolution, and there are no plans for a third new member of The Shield.
Quote:

Adam Rose being off Raw this week is an indication already that they are cooling off on the character. Vince McMahon, who makes all the key choices, isn’t the easiest one to get to accept new people as main players. He’s said not to be completely sold on any of the recent characters. Bo Dallas’ push is still continuing on almost every show. Kevin Dunn apparently buried Rose and Vince isn’t sold on him either. That’s why Paige has the title but little character developmental has been done her. Dunn right now is a huge proponent of Fox, so her gimmick will continue to be featured.
Quote:

Lots of rumors of long-term plans of a physical Hall of Fame and wrestling museum as WWE has gone to a lot of historians and made some good money offers for memorabilia. Vince McMahon has never had interest in this, but Paul Levesque seems to be the point guy on this idea.
Quote:

The talk this week was of fast tracking Kalisto to the main roster by the end of the year. The company feels the need to have a Latino babyface star and they’ve clearly given up on Sin Cara and Los Matadores as anything more than prelim level.
Quote:

As I suspected last week, the Tyson Kidd as a masked man thing is looking less likely. It now looks like he’s going to go heel.

Dirtsheets:

Quote:

Originally Posted by Observer
At one point, WWE officials did talk about making Dean Ambrose turn on The Shield before. While the Seth Rollins turn was a late decision, it's said that it wasn't an Ambrose turn changed into a Rollins turn.

Quote:

Originally Posted by PWI
Based on the success of Warrior Week on the WWE Network, the company is looking at doing a number of "themed-weeks" in the future. WWE Network recently sent out a survey to fans seeking feedback on "themed-weeks" for CM Punk, Steve Austin, The Rock, Randy Savage, The Hardys, The Authority, The Kliq, Hulk Hogan, Andre the Giant, Sting, Lex Luger, Christian and Alberto Del Rio.

Quote:

Chris Jericho announced on Twitter that WWE Superstar and former Tag Team partner Christian will be on his Talk is Jericho podcast very soon.
Quote:

Originally Posted by PWI
As noted earlier, WWE released 11 talents today - Teddy Long, referee Marc Harris, Evan Bourne, JTG, Brodus Clay, Curt Hawkins, Aksana, Yoshi Tatsu, Camacho, Jinder Mahal and Drew McIntyre. Regarding Tatsu, there had been a feeling for some time that he had really regressed in the ring. It's said that Brodus Clay fell out of favor with WWE creative. Long's contract expired and it was well known within WWE that he would be leaving soon. Out of all 11 releases, the releases of Camacho and Hawkins came as the bigger surprises to people within WWE. Camacho was very popular within NXT circles and Hawkins had several more years left on his current deal

Quote:

Originally Posted by PWI
Word is that Mark Carrano, who has been featured on Total Divas and works in Talent Relations under Triple H, is the person who made most, if not all, of the WWE releases today by phone. There is a lot of talk among people in WWE that the cuts are not done and that there will be more releases on the administrative side of the company, possibly as soon as tomorrow. It's said that the success, or lack thereof, of the WWE Network is what is causing the talent cuts and the potential office cuts.
